Course Outcomes
Synthesis and Integration
Integrate topics from various civil engineering disciplines to solve realistic problems
Database Management
Obtain and evaluate appropriate input information from databases, handbooks, correlation, experiments and literature
Locating Geographic Data
Know where to locate, and how to prepare geographic datasets for use in a GIS
GIS Spatial Analysis
Use GIS tools for spatial analysis, understanding and design of engineering systems
Map Generation
Produce professional maps and technical reports from geographic data for use in written and oral presentations
GIS Customization
Customize, or use customized scripts to solve engineering-specific problems with GIS
Professional Communication
Compose professional documents in a clear, concise, and effective manner
